Output 43c80aade21b402bad59458ed83cf68dc26e7d2a374a6c7974f2af282a87e77f:0

value
869181
script pubkey
OP_0 OP_PUSHBYTES_20 6391f6fd29e374e2639842e75659122ea4995ee9
address
bc1qvwgldlffud6wycucgtn4vkgj96jfjhhf9r8a7h
transaction
43c80aade21b402bad59458ed83cf68dc26e7d2a374a6c7974f2af282a87e77f
spent
true